Report: Seahawks QB Geno Smith shouldn't miss time due to injuries
Jul 27, 2024; Renton, WA, USA; Seattle Seahawks quarterback Geno Smith (7) jogs off the field after training camp at Virginia Mason Athletic Center. Mandatory Credit: Steven Bisig-USA TODAY Sports Seattle Seahawks quarterback Geno Smith is not expected to miss any time after tests for knee and hip injuries did not reveal any significant damage, ESPN reported on Friday.
Smith didn't take part in the Seahawks' walk-through Wednesday and watched from the sideline on Thursday when the team resumed practicing in pads.
Seahawks head coach Mike Macdonald said Thursday that Smith has been "working through a couple of things from the other day."
With Smith out, offseason acquisition Sam Howell -- who came over in a March trade with the Washington Commanders -- took first-team reps on Wednesday and Thursday. Former Carolina Panthers signal-caller PJ Walker is Seattle's third-string QB.
Smith, 33, completed 64.7 percent of his passes for 3,624 yards with 20 touchdowns and nine interceptions in 15 games last season. He was named to his second straight Pro Bowl last season.
